I’ve had the chance to partner with some really fantastic brands and organizations over the years, and they’ve definitely shaped my content and the opportunities I’ve been able to share with my community.
On the brand side, companies like Samsung, General Mills, and Dream Kids have been pivotal collaborators. They’ve allowed me to blend real family life, tech, food, and beauty into content that still feels authentic to who I am and how we live.
Equally important are the platforms and conferences that have trusted me to speak and share my story: BlogHer, Women in Travel (WITS), Mom 2.0, Blogalicious, National Box Tops University, and various Illinois Farm Bureau and agricultural summits. Those stages helped expand my reach and deepen my role as a storyteller and advocate.
Habitat for Humanity has also been a cornerstone collaboration in my journey. Partnering with them as a family, then using that experience to help launch our community garden and homesteading content, really tied together my passions for family, service, and food access.
